Notes

Brown is the CSS named color closest to the dictionary definition of the word: a deep, warm, reddish-tan. Despite the name, the hex sits in the red family by hue, just at low enough lightness to register as earthen rather than fiery. Brown shows up in heritage branding for coffee, leather goods, and outdoor equipment as the dominant tone. Cream and brass accents sit well alongside, as does sage green for a vintage palette. On the web it is rare as a primary action color because it competes with red for attention without the same urgency cues, which can confuse users.

What colors pair well with Brown?

Its complementary color is #006D79. Triadic partners are #007316 and #3255B6; analogous neighbours are #974200 and #9E2961.
